What does SIBL0000981 mean?

SIBL0000981
SIBL — Bank code. Identifies South Indian Bank. All branches of South Indian Bank share this prefix.
0 — Reserved character. Always zero in every IFSC code in India.
000981 — Branch code. Uniquely identifies the KONGAD branch within South Indian Bank.
